Introducing WordPress.org and Hopscotch
Different products excel in different areas, so the best platform for your business will depend on your specific needs and requirements.
WordPress.org covers Content Management with Website, Communication Management with Website, Social Media Management with Social Media, Engagement Management with Website, etc.
Hopscotch focuses on Engagement Management with Mobile, Social Media Management with Social Media, Content Management with Mobile, Communication Management with Social Media, etc.
